Analysis

Zimbabwe recorded 2.47 % for gender gap in the completion rate, upper secondary, rural — value in 2019.

That represents a change of up 91.5% over ten years.

Over the whole period, gender gap in the completion rate, upper secondary, rural — value in Zimbabwe peaked at 2.82 % in 2014 and was at its lowest, 1.29 %, in 2010.

Zimbabwe ranks 17th of 73 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.

The Suite of Gender Indicators presents a set of indicators relevant to agrifood systems that are disaggregated by sex, with the aim of highlighting gender differences across agrifood systems. The initial set of indicators is based on those used in FAO’s 2023 Status of Women in Agrifood Systems (SWAFS) report and on the recommendations of an expert consultation held in December 2023, and covers key dimensions including economic participation, governance, agency, social norms, assets and services, education, health, and nutrition. Indicator selection was informed by expert judgment and by the availability of data with sufficient geographic and temporal coverage to enable meaningful comparisons across regions and over time. While most indicators are produced and published by FAO and other international organizations, the objective of this domain is to provide a one-stop shop for sex-disaggregated data on agrifood systems.
